Area/TopicMontenegro, Western Balkans, Adventure Travel Guide TrainingHayley WrightOwner/OperatorBlack Mountain MontenegroInspired by adventurous parents and after journeying to and living in some of the world's colder places (including the North Pole and Siberia) Hayley turned a passion for adventure travel into a full time job as co-owner/ operator of an adventure travel business together with husband Jack in beautiful Montenegro. The destination is fast becoming known for its incredible mountain and coastal landscapes, rivers,lakes and canyons together with the melting pot of culture, warm Balkan hospitality and endless outdoor adventure opportunities. Working beyond borders throughout Montenegro and the Western Balkan region with a community of fantastic local guides and partners enables our guests to enjoy authentic and often transformational travel experiences, pushing their own boundaries in both physical challenges and cultural discoveries. Hayley is also a member of the Adventure Travel Guide Standard governance board, a framework of global standards of excellence for adventure travel guides and is  passionate about supporting adventure guiding as a serious and respected profession which provides sustainable stewardship for the places and people through whose lands we travel.https://www.montenegroholiday.com/SummaryHayley Wright, the founder of Black Mountain Montenegro, shares her journey from working in the oil industry to becoming an adventure travel operator in Montenegro. She discusses the country's potential for adventure tourism and its unique geographical features, including its mountainous terrain and deep canyons. Hayley highlights the characteristics of Montenegrin people, their hospitality, and their pride in their culture and food. She also talks about the challenges and rewards of running a tourism business in Montenegro, as well as the importance of adventure travel guides and the Adventure Travel Guide Standard. In this conversation, Jason Elkins speaks with Hayley about adventure travel and the importance of creating wonderful experiences worldwide. They discuss the passion for adventure travel, building a community of adventure travel guides, exploring the Western Balkans, and the impact of creating memorable experiences around the world.TakeawaysMontenegro offers a unique adventure tourism experience with its mountainous terrain, deep canyons, and diverse cultural heritage.The Montenegrin people are known for their hospitality, genuine warmth, and pride in their culture and food.Adventure travel guides play a crucial role in providing safe and memorable experiences for travelers, and their profession should be recognized and supported.Montenegro's adventure tourism industry has grown significantly in recent years, offering activities such as hiking, kayaking, stand-up paddleboarding, and ski touring.Travelers should be prepared for a laid-back and relaxed lifestyle in Montenegro, where time is not a priority and enjoying life is valued. Adventure travel is a global phenomenon that brings people together and creates a sense of community.Building a community of adventure travel guides fosters collaboration and shared experiences.The Western Balkans, including Montenegro, Croatia, Albania, Serbia, Bosnia, and Macedonia, offer unique and exciting destinations for travelers.Creating wonderful experiences in different parts of the world helps make the world feel smaller and more connected.
